HB1203

DMV; requires any person submitting form to provide proof of current address.

Status:
In House

Latest Action: Feb. 3, 2026
House: Subcommittee recommends laying on the table (7-Y 3-N)

Chief Patron:
Phillip Scott (R)

Session:
2026 Regular Session

Summary

As Introduced. Department of Motor Vehicles; addresses.

Authorizes the Department of Motor Vehicles (the Department) to require any person submitting a form for which he must provide his current address, at the time of submission of such form, to present proof of residence at such current address. The bill authorizes the owner or lessee of any real property in the Commonwealth to notify the Department if the address of the real property is used for the issuance of a driver's license or special identification card that does not belong to any owner, lessee, or resident of the real property, and, provided certain conditions are met, authorizes the Department to revoke such driver's license or special identification card. Current law authorizes such a process in cases in which real property is used for the titling or registration of a vehicle that does not belong to any owner, lessee, or resident of such real property. The bill also authorizes, for both such cases when such certain conditions are met, the Department to disassociate the address from any account the person to whom the driver's license or special identification card was issued or the vehicle owner, respectively, holds with the Department.
